[04/15] wpa_supplicant: Refactor Radio Measurement Request handling

From: Avraham Stern <avraham.stern@intel.com>

Extract the code dealing with processing the measurement request
elements to a separate function.
This will be needed for beacon report requests processing.

Signed-off-by: Avraham Stern <avraham.stern@intel.com>
---
 wpa_supplicant/rrm.c | 119 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++--------------------
 1 file changed, 73 insertions(+), 46 deletions(-)
